Disk exhaustion via unbounded Tlon media downloads
Published Apr 28, 2026 · Updated Apr 28, 2026
Resource exhaustion in OpenClaw before 2026.3.31 allows remote authenticated users to fill local storage through Tlon image messages. The Tlon extension's downloadMedia path streamed every referenced image directly into the workspace media directory without byte, count, or managed-cleanup limits. A user able to post Tlon content can force repeated inbound downloads until disk exhaustion interrupts the gateway or other host services.
